X \r\n\r\nIn physics, you can calculate angular momentum in the same way that you calculate linear momentum just substitute moment of inertia for mass, and angular velocity for velocity.\r\n

What is angular momentum?

\r\nAngular momentum is the quantity of rotation of a body, which is the product of its moment of inertia and its angular velocity.\r\n\r\nLinear momentum, p, is defined as the product of mass and velocity:\r\n\r\np = mv\r\n\r\nThis is a quantity that is conserved when there are no external forces acting. In physics, you can calculate angular momentum in the same way that you calculate linear momentum just substitute moment of inertia for mass, and angular velocity for velocity. Using the law of conservation of momentum, you can equate the total momentum before a collision to the total momentum after it to solve problems.
